CRUISE CONTROL SYSTEM TC and CG Terminal Circuit

DESCRIPTION

Connecting terminals TC and CG of the DLC3 causes the system to enter self-diagnostic mode. If a malfunction is present, the cruise control indicator light will blink.

Tech Tips

When a particular warning light remains blinking, a ground short in the wiring of terminal TC of the DLC3 or an internal ground short in the relevant ECU is suspected.
